Exegesis

The finite verb ḗrxanto {ἤρξαντο | ḗrxanto} “they began” takes as its subject the nominal phrase hápan to plḗthos tōn mathētōn {ἅπαν τὸ πλῆθος τῶν μαθητῶν | hápan to plḗthos tōn mathētōn}, emphasizing the full scope of the disciples.

In contextLuke 19:37

And as He drew near—already at the descent of the Mount of Olives—the whole multitude of the disciples began rejoicing and praising God with a loud voice for all the mighty works they had seen.
